Homemade Nutella
Making your own homemade nutella is so easy, you need to give it a try!
Equipment
- 1 blender or food processor
Ingredients
- 2 cups hazelnuts
- 1-2 tbsp coconut oil *see notes
- 1/3 cup maple syrup
- 1/4 cup almond milk *see notes
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/4 cup cacao powder
- pinch of salt
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 180°c and line a baking tray.
- Add hazelnuts to the baking tray and roast for 10 minutes (note: if you're using roasted hazelnuts you can skip this step)
- Once roasted, let cool slightly and rub them together using a tea towel to remove the skin.
- Add hazelnuts to a high powdered blender or food processor and blend until they form a nut butter, scraping down the sides of the food processor when necessary. If it isn't forming a nut butter add in 1-2tbsp of coconut oil to help it come together.
- Once the hazelnuts have formed a nut butter, add in the vanilla extract, cacao powder, maple syrup, salt, almond milk and blend until smooth. Start with 1/4 cup of almond milk and add more if it's not coming together.
- Once smooth add into a jar and store in the fridge!
Notes
*when you’re blending the hazelnuts you can add in some coconut oil if it’s not forming a nut butter consistency.
**start by adding 1/4 cup of almond milk and add a dash more if needed.
Store in the fridge, it lasts for a few weeks
